Supression of ionization in strong laser fields

We analyze the excitation of atoms by intense pulsed laser fields and describe the formation of spatially extended wave packets and substantial inhibition of ionization. A number of physical effects lead to inhibited ionization: We establish through a combination of numerical and analytical methods that one such effect is Raman mixing of intermediate Rydberg levels.
